🧠 M&A Optionality, Talent Over Headlines

NVIDIA is reportedly in advanced talks to acquire AI21 Labs for $2B to $3B. AI21 builds enterprise LLM tooling and was last valued at $1.4B with Nvidia and Google backing. This is not about buying a product. It is about securing elite AI talent and deepening Nvidia’s Israeli AI footprint. Strategic optionality is expanding, not peaking.

📈 Options Market Confirms Control, Not Fear

NVDA’s volatility surface shows a calm front end with short-dated implied volatility sitting near the mid-30% range, while longer expiries price in materially wider future swings. The smile curve is flatter, signalling reduced panic demand for downside puts. This is measured positioning. The liquidity flush already happened. Dealers are not being forced to chase hedges.

💰 Valuation Disconnect Is Now Impossible to Ignore

Nvidia trades around the mid-20s forward P/E versus Costco in the low-40s. Yet long-term EPS growth expectations sit near +37% for NVDA versus +9% for COST. Growth is being priced at a discount. That asymmetry rarely persists once flow, structure, and fundamentals align.

📊 Options Flow Confirms Duration, Not Just Direction

The options prints add an important layer. This is not short-dated speculation, it is long-duration positioning.

On $SLV, the Jan 16 2026 $69 calls show heavy ask-side execution with large size transacting despite an intraday pullback. Premium held near $3.90 even as price faded, signalling conviction through volatility rather than panic exits. This is classic longer-term exposure being built into weakness, not chased strength.

$TSLA flow is even more telling. Feb 20 2026 $635 and $665 calls saw concentrated volume bursts around 11:00am, with single candles printing $567K to $1.26M in premium. Average fills clustered near the ask, not mid. That tells you buyers were willing to pay for time and convexity, not scalp gamma.

What matters here is expiry selection. February 2026 is not about this week’s headline or next CPI print. It is a structural bet on trend persistence, product execution, and scale. When participants reach that far out the curve, they are expressing regime confidence, not trading noise.

Taken together with NVDA’s flatter volatility smile and subdued front-end IV, this flow reinforces the same message across leaders. Fear is not being bid. Duration is being accumulated. Liquidity is rotating into long-term upside structures.

This is how institutional positioning looks when leadership is being reaffirmed, not distributed.

🌍 Macro and the Compute Arms Race Remain Supportive

Fed minutes from the December meeting reveal a tighter split than headlines suggested. Some officials preferred no cut, others could have held steady, while the majority supported easing. Policy remains data dependent, keeping volatility alive into 2026. At the same time, Elon Musk’s xAI has reportedly secured a third supersized data-center site outside Memphis, adjacent to its existing footprint. Compute demand continues to accelerate beneath the surface, directly feeding Nvidia’s ecosystem.

🚗 Tesla Confirms Leadership Rotation Is Real

$TSLA adds confirmation. Model Y is officially the best-selling car of 2025 for the third year running. Tesla has confirmed Cybercab production has started. On 30Dec, Tesla’s 9 millionth vehicle rolled off the line at Gigafactory Shanghai 🇨🇳 and it was a Model Y. Line up all 9 million Teslas bumper to bumper and they stretch around the Equator 🌏. This is scale, momentum, and manufacturing dominance reinforcing the AI and automation complex.
